Output 3664bfe78ba3cf08faa60ea8669f9bb6364e32c80f00c6542e9d5b8d86cb2e7c:1

value
23331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de2b7e3530aba0582b5293d2cfb2c6944f5eb3a OP_EQUAL
address
34R37mh4nu4aN5RN7P3oUHyfgdubPkCeyQ
transaction
3664bfe78ba3cf08faa60ea8669f9bb6364e32c80f00c6542e9d5b8d86cb2e7c
spent
true